Safety First:

One of the primary functions of industrial uniforms in the UAE is to provide a layer of protection for workers. These uniforms are designed with the inherent risks of the job in mind. For instance, workers in the construction industry are exposed to hazards such as falling debris and harsh weather conditions. Their uniforms are typically made from durable materials that can withstand wear and tear while offering protection against potential injuries.

In the oil and gas industry, where workers deal with flammable materials and chemicals, fire-resistant uniforms are a standard requirement. These uniforms are designed to resist ignition and protect workers from burns in the event of an accident. Additionally, high-visibility uniforms are common in industries where workers are exposed to moving vehicles, ensuring they remain visible to drivers and machinery operators.

Customization and Adaptation:

The industrial uniform industry in the UAE is highly adaptable and customizable. Companies can tailor uniforms to suit their specific needs and industry requirements. This flexibility allows businesses to incorporate the latest safety technologies and materials into their uniforms to provide the highest level of protection to their employees.

For instance, some uniforms are equipped with RFID (Radio-Frequency Identification) tags, which can be used to track the location and movements of workers in real-time. This technology enhances safety by allowing companies to respond quickly in case of an emergency.

Sustainability and Comfort:

In recent years, there has been a growing emphasis on sustainability in the UAE's industrial uniform sector. Manufacturers are increasingly using eco-friendly materials and production processes to reduce the environmental impact of uniforms. This aligns with the UAE's broader commitment to sustainability and reducing its carbon footprint.

Additionally, comfort is a key consideration in the design of modern industrial uniforms. Workers in the UAE often face extreme temperatures, and their uniforms are designed to provide both protection and comfort. Breathable fabrics, moisture-wicking properties, and ergonomic designs are all integrated into these uniforms to ensure that workers can perform their duties comfortably, even in challenging conditions.
